Professional Role and Responsibilities in Snooker Officiating
Sue Vincent plays a crucial role in maintaining fairness and discipline during professional snooker matches. As a referee, her primary responsibility is to ensure that the laws of the game are applied correctly and consistently throughout each frame. This includes judging fouls, monitoring shot timing, and confirming correct ball placement, all of which demand intense concentration and precision.
A significant part of her role involves managing the pace and flow of the match. By making clear and confident decisions, she helps prevent unnecessary delays and confusion at the table. This balance between authority and calmness is essential, especially during high-pressure situations where players’ focus and emotions may be tested.
Sue Vincent is also responsible for overseeing complex situations such as free balls, miss rulings, and re-spotted balls. These moments require not only a deep understanding of the rules but also the confidence to make instant decisions that can influence the outcome of a frame. Accuracy in such situations is critical to preserving the integrity of the competition.
Communication is another important aspect of her responsibilities. Through clear verbal calls and precise hand signals, she ensures that players, officials, and spectators understand each ruling. Effective communication minimizes disputes and reinforces trust in the officiating process.
Overall, her professional role extends beyond technical enforcement. By combining rule knowledge, authority, and composure, Sue Vincent contributes significantly to the smooth conduct of professional snooker matches.
